#数字货币市场回升 shook three times in the early morning push.



Upon opening it, it's that ID again. "Is there still hope?" You can hear the sobbing tone in the voice.

This is already the seventh time, three months.

I sent a screenshot over—his liquidation points were densely packed near key price levels. "What did you see?" After five minutes he replied: "Am I being targeted?" "It's not targeting, it's that you're too easy to predict." Those big funds love these types of traders; their stop-loss levels are written all over their faces.

I have seen all his previous actions: following short video calls and going all in, jumping in to take over after seeing others' screenshots of profits. Later, I set strict rules for him—he must withdraw from all trading groups, and can open a maximum of two trades a day, regardless of whether he makes a profit or a loss.

The first time I saw him testing the waters with 30U, he clearly felt very constrained. "What's the point of such a small position?" But after making 15U that time, he said he hadn't slept this soundly in six months.

The turning point was the day the ETH spot ETF was approved.

The whole network is celebrating. I sent a message: "The money is still on the way, what's the rush?" Unexpectedly, this guy got the idea—he shorted at the 3680 position. That night, a bunch of people got wrecked at the peak, and he made a 30% profit and called it a day. When he called back, his voice was different: "I feel like I've found some insight."

The real test is in September.

During the time when Bitcoin dropped 10% in a single day, I messaged him a few hours in advance: "Get ready to buy around 3900." Later he said he was shaking a lot at that time and hesitated for a long time before placing the order. When it rebounded in the early morning, he sent me a firework emoticon.

"How do you determine that?" he asked.

I sent a message about the farmer's market location: "I went to buy groceries in the morning, and the owner said that due to the typhoon, seafood prices have gone up and there's no stock. Those big players are all having tea and meals, who would dump their stocks at this time?"

One year later, Winter Solstice.

He invited me to dinner at an old tea house. Looking at the stable growth curve of his account, I knew he understood - anyone can read technical indicators, but in this market full of stories of sudden wealth, holding onto basic common sense is the hardest thing to do. "If the vegetable heart costs three dollars and is too expensive, I won't buy it," it's that simple.

A few young people at the next table are talking about a hundred times leverage, and their voices are very loud.

I took a sip of tea and said nothing. He smiled and looked out at the sycamore tree. Sunlight filtered through the leaves, shimmering on the table.

This guy has come back to life.
